When discussing Gucci fashion design sketches, it is essential to delve into the history and heritage of the brand. Gucci was founded in 1921 by Guccio Gucci, a visionary entrepreneur who started the brand as a small leather goods company in Florence, Italy. Over the years, Gucci expanded its offerings to include ready-to-wear clothing, accessories, and footwear, becoming synonymous with luxury and sophistication.
Throughout its history, Gucci has been led by a series of creative directors who have left their mark on the brand's design legacy. Some of the most famous fashion designers to have helmed Gucci include Tom Ford, Alessandro Michele, and Frida Giannini. Tom Ford, in particular, is credited with revitalizing the brand in the 1990s and transforming it into a global powerhouse of fashion and luxury.
